[Bacula-users] symbol lookup error: /usr/lib/libbaccats-7.0.2.so: undefined

2014-04-28 Thread selanty
Hi Jim,

Sry didn't post a reply earlier but was not able to till now.
The problem is solved i got a direct reply.

this did the trick
===
The short answer to the problem is that with the default Makefile for the 
src/cats diretory, the build cannot find the libmysqlclient_r on Ubuntu 12.04. 
I'm not exactly sure why the configure works but the Makefile is not built 
properly but I am really out of my element when I get deep into building 
software on linux. At any rate, to get Bacula to build on Ubuntu 12.04.02 with 
mysql, use the proper configure file and make sure that works as expected. Then 
edit the src/cats/Makefile produced and change the line MYSQL_LIBS = to 
MYSQL_LIBS = -L/usr/lib/i386-linux-gnu -lmysqlclient_r

Note that this was the proper path for my Ubuntu 12.04.02 LTS 32 bit 
installation, but you may have a different path).
===
so every thing is runnig fine now.

[Bacula-users] Bacula setup driving me nuts

2011-08-23 Thread selanty
Hi all,

I have a strange problem when i try to mount a tape.
First what i have i use centos 5.4 with bacula 5.0.3
Hardware is an IBM TS3100 (3573-TL) with 2 LTO5 (ULT3580-HH5)

config from bacula-sd.conf
Autochanger {
Name = Autochanger
Device = LTO5_1, LTO5_2
Changer Device = /dev/sg5
Changer Command = /etc/bacula/mtx-changer %c %o %S %a %d
}

Device {
Name = LTO5_1
Drive Index = 0
Media Type = LTO5
Archive Device = /dev/st0
Autochanger = yes
Automatic Mount = yes
Always Open = yes
Removable Media = yes
Random Access = no
Requires Mount = no
Maximum Job Spool Size = 12G
Spool directory = /var/spool
Label Type = Bacula
Check Labels = yes
Label Media = no
}

Device {
Name = LTO5_2
Drive Index = 1
Media Type = LTO5
Archive Device = /dev/st1
Autochanger = yes
Automatic Mount = yes
Always Open = yes
Removable Media = yes
Random Access = no
Requires Mount = no
Maximum Job Spool Size = 12G
Spool directory = /var/spool
Label Type = Bacula
Check Labels = yes
LabelMedia = no

Config from bacula-dir.conf
Storage {
  Name = AutoChanger
  Password = host
  Address = snlbck01.steltix.local
  SDPort = 9103
  Device = Autochanger
  Media Type = LTO5
  Autochanger = yes
  Maximum Concurrent Jobs = 20

What happens if i want to mount a tape from console i do the following and get 
the following.
*mount
Automatically selected Catalog: MyCatalog
Using Catalog MyCatalog
The defined Storage resources are:
 1: File
 2: AutoChanger
Select Storage resource (1-2): 2
Connecting to Storage daemon AutoChanger at snlbck01.steltix.local:9103 ...
Enter autochanger drive[0]: 0
Enter autochanger slot: 5
3301 Issuing autochanger loaded? drive 0 command.
3302 Autochanger loaded? drive 0, result: nothing loaded.
3304 Issuing autochanger load slot 5, drive 0 command.
3992 Bad autochanger load slot 5, drive 0: ERR=Child died from signal 15: 
Termination.
Results=Program killed by Bacula (timeout)

3301 Issuing autochanger loaded? drive 0 command.
3302 Autochanger loaded? drive 0, result is Slot 5.
3901 Unable to open device LTO5_1 (/dev/st0): ERR=dev.c:491 Unable to open 
device LTO5_1 (/dev/st0): ERR=No medium found

Then i ask the Status and get the following
*status
Status available for:
 1: Director
 2: Storage
 3: Client
 4: All
Select daemon type for status (1-4): 2
The defined Storage resources are:
 1: File
 2: AutoChanger
Select Storage resource (1-2): 2
Connecting to Storage daemon AutoChanger at snlbck01.steltix.local:9103

snlbck01.steltix.local-sd Version: 5.0.3 (04 August 2010) i686-pc-linux-gnu 
redhat
Daemon started 23-Aug-11 14:20. Jobs: run=0, running=0.
 Heap: heap=135,168 smbytes=24,942 max_bytes=122,999 bufs=100 max_bufs=108
Sizes: boffset_t=8 size_t=4 int32_t=4 int64_t=8

Device status:
Autochanger Autochanger with devices:
   LTO5_1 (/dev/st0)
   LTO5_2 (/dev/st1)
Device FileStorage (/tmp) is not open.
Device LTO5_1 (/dev/st0) is not open.
Slot 5 is loaded in drive 0.
Device LTO5_2 (/dev/st1) is not open.
Drive 1 status unknown.


Used Volume status:

so the tape is loaded in the correct drive but not mounted. then i try another 
mount
*mount
The defined Storage resources are:
 1: File
 2: AutoChanger
Select Storage resource (1-2): 2
Enter autochanger drive[0]: 0
Enter autochanger slot:
3901 Unable to open device LTO5_1 (/dev/st0): ERR=dev.c:491 Unable to open 
device LTO5_1 (/dev/st0): ERR=No medium found

wont mount and then i do the following mount.
*mount
The defined Storage resources are:
 1: File
 2: AutoChanger
Select Storage resource (1-2): 2
Enter autochanger drive[0]: 1
Enter autochanger slot:
3301 Issuing autochanger loaded? drive 1 command.
3302 Autochanger loaded? drive 1, result: nothing loaded.
3001 Mounted Volume: SCR02
3001 Device LTO5_2 (/dev/st1) is already mounted with Volume SCR02

and the tape is mounted to LTO5_2 while it should LTO5_1
if ask for status it tells me this
Device status:
Autochanger Autochanger with devices:
   LTO5_1 (/dev/st0)
   LTO5_2 (/dev/st1)
Device FileStorage (/tmp) is not open.
Device LTO5_1 (/dev/st0) is not open.
Slot 5 is loaded in drive 0.
Device LTO5_2 (/dev/st1) is mounted with:
Volume:  SCR02
Pool:*unknown*
Media type:  LTO5
Drive 1 status unknown.
Total Bytes Read=64,512 Blocks Read=1 Bytes/block=64,512
Positioned at File=1 Block=0


Used Volume status:
SCR02 on device LTO5_2 (/dev/st1)
Reader=0 writers=0 devres=0 volinuse=0

I am totaly lost i asked at first to mount on drive 0 LTO and ending up on 
LTO5_2 it does this with jobs to when i manualy move the tape to drive1 the 
jobs goes further
What could be wrong i dont know anymore
btw i am a newby with bacula so dont shoot me for asking stupid things i 
googled and googled but couldnt find anything about it.

Regards Marcel
